Weight overlap is an ETFIQ calculation: for every security both funds hold, the smaller of the two weights, summed. Above 50%, holding both is close to holding one of them twice. Holdings dated Jun 30, 2026 and May 31, 2026.

IBB in plain words

IBB is an index equity fund tracking the Biotechnology. Over the year to Sep 11, 2026 it returned +41.5% with distributions reinvested, against +17.5% for the S&P 500 and +23.0% for the Nasdaq-100. The prospectus expense ratio is 0.44% a year. By its holdings filed for Jun 30, 2026, 36% of the fund by weight is stocks the S&P 500 also holds, across 248 positions, with the top ten at 44.8%. It sat 6.5% below its high of Aug 19, 2026 on Sep 11, 2026.

SHY in plain words

SHY is a bond fund tracking the 1-3 Year Treasury Bond. Over the year to Sep 11, 2026 it returned +1.7% with distributions reinvested, against +17.5% for the S&P 500 and +23.0% for the Nasdaq-100. The prospectus expense ratio is 0.15% a year.
